The CV4083 (commercial S6F33F) is a modified CV2209 and is a miniature HF pentode with flying leads rather than pins. Typical operating conditions are found in the attached data-sheet.The CV4083 was designed for dual control as can be seen by the close wound suppressor grid.The KB/F identifies this valve as being made to specification K1001 or K1006, the B denotes qualification by a UK authority and the F identifies the maker as STC, Paignton.
The open construction.The thin glass tube envelope is 18 mm diameter and excluding the B7G base pins, is 44 mm tall.Reference: Data-sheet. Type CV4083 was first introduced in 1958. See also 1958 adverts. |
